Dead Coin Battery

A dead battery is the main reason for your Fiat 500 keyfob not locking or unlocking the doors. The battery inside the key fob will deplete quickly when you don't use it often enough. If your remote is beginning to show signs of a loss of range or has stopped working or not responding, then the battery could be dead.

The battery in the key fob is secured by metal clips that hold it in place. If the clips aren't tight enough, they can cause contact issues that will stop the remote from receiving power. By using a small flathead screwdriver, pry the retaining clip open to remove the battery and then insert a fresh one. Use a battery that has the same voltage, size and specifications as the original.

Water Damage

Damage to your water supply could be the reason behind your key fob's not functioning properly. The rubber seals on key fobs protect them from getting damaged by a slight drizzle or replacement fiat 500 key fob splash of water. However, it is essential to keep the keys of your car away from the washing machine, the ocean and pool.

The key fob is equipped with an electronic chip that sends a message to the immobilizer system of your vehicle. The chip allows the 500 to be locked and started. If it gets wet it won't function.

Try cleaning the inside electronics of your keyfob with isopropyl alcohol or an electronic cleaner to determine whether they're still working. It is recommended to replace the key fob if it has been submerged into salt water rather than attempting to fix it yourself.

Faulty Chip

The chip located within the key fob communicates with your car's immobiliser unit to ensure the car is capable of starting when the correct key is used. If the chip is damaged, or damaged in any way the car won't start.

A chip that is damaged can happen due to many reasons, but most often it is due to water damage or the battery being dead. Whatever the reason, it is best to delegate the job to a locksmith who can replace the chip quickly and at a cost-effective price.

If your key fob will not work after exposure to water that is clean from the tap or rain take the battery off. Wipe down the electronic component with a paper towel. If the key fob doesn't work it's probably a fried chip and will need to be replaced.

Faulty Receiver Module

Fiat key fobs send an electronic signal to the vehicle which will unlock and close doors (and start the car if it has an automatic transmission) up to 50 feet. There are several reasons why the fob may not function. This includes a dead coin battery damaged by water, worn buttons, replacement fiat 500 Key Fob a receiver module issue and signal interference, or an electronic chip that has failed.

If the fob was in the pocket of someone who has suffered severe trauma (such as being dropped on the floor or washed in a washing machine), it may not be able to communicate with the Body Control Module (BCM) of the car. The BCM is a security system which will only accept signals from genuine keys.
